Afreximbank launches US$3 Billion Revolving Intra-African Oil Import Financing Programme

This programme seeks to leverage the growing refining capacity that Afreximbank has helped establish across the continent, while aligning with the objectives of the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A) agreement

To address Africa's persistent reliance on imported refined petroleum products, which accounted for an amount of US$30billion annually in petroleum import costs due to inadequate refining, African Export-Import Bank (Afreximbank) (www.Afreximbank.com) has launched a US$3 Billion Revolving Intra-African Oil Trade Financing Programme to finance the purchase of refined petroleum products…

Lesotho’s human rights record to be examined by Universal Periodic Review

The UPR is a peer review of the human rights records of all 193 UN Member States

The human rights record of Lesotho will be examined by the United Nations Human Rights Council’s Universal Periodic Review (UPR) Working Group for the fourth time on Wednesday, 30 April 2025, in a meeting in Geneva that will be webcast live. Lesotho is one of 14 States to be reviewed by the…
